Reinspect Closed Inspections
Background
Reinspections are a crucial step to ensure that any previously identified issues have been properly fixed. By creating a reinspection, you can verify that all work meets project standards and that any potential risks have been reduced.
Things to Consider
The previous inspection will close after the reinspection is created.
You cannot reinspect an inspection that has already been reinspected.
You cannot reinspect an invalid reinspection.

Steps
Navigate to the Project level Inspections tool.
Click View next to the inspection you want to reinspect.
Click the ellipsis
icon, then click Reinspect.
This option is only visible to users with the 'Create a Reinspection' permission.
It will also not appear if the inspection has already been reinspected or if it is an invalid reinspection of a previous one.
If the inspection is not yet closed, a warning message will appear: "Creating a reinspection will close this inspection."
Click Continue to proceed or click Cancel to return to the original inspection.
A new 'child inspection' is created.
All line items from the previous inspection will carry over.
Line items that previously passed will retain their passed status.
